100m from Lee Jae-myung's fasting site, ruling party mukbang... Jeon Yong-gi criticizes as "Ilbe in a suit"

People Power Party Posts on Jeon Yong-gi Democratic Party Member's Facebook About Seafood Consumption Promotion Event

The People Power Party strongly criticized Democratic Party lawmaker Jeon Yong-gi, who called the event held near Lee Jae-myung, the leader of the Democratic Party, where seafood tasting events were held to promote seafood consumption, "like an Ilbe member in a suit."


On the 7th, Jeon said on his Facebook, "Since the Yoon Seok-yeol government no longer communicates properly, they belittled the fasting by calling it fake fasting, and now they are even doing a mukbang next to the fasting site," expressing his strong criticism.

Earlier, the People Power Party's 'Protect Our Sea Verification TF' announced that it would hold a seafood consumption promotion event for one million fishermen at the National Assembly Communication Office on the 8th. The event location is about 100 meters away from the tent where Lee, who is fasting, is staying. The event is also known to include seafood sales and free tasting for National Assembly staff and reporters covering the National Assembly.


He pointed out, "I still have a headache recalling the shameless people who did mukbang at the fasting site, but I never imagined seeing this mockery again at the National Assembly, the hall of public opinion," adding, "According to reports, a ruling party lawmaker even mocked Lee Jae-myung, who is fasting, saying, 'Don't be embarrassed, come and eat.'


Jeon said, "It seems they have given up being human beyond just politically attacking," and criticized, "They still don't seem to realize that the blade of words they throw at others will eventually come back to them."
